Yoga on High hosts Summer Potluck and Talent Show on July 16
Not quite meditation, but it's still good for the soul

By Rae Hellard


This year, the Short North district’s very own Yoga on High will be hosting a community potluck and talent show for interested residents. On July 16 at 7:30 p.m. visitors can watch the local talent demonstrate their skills while enjoying a great vegetarian smorgasbord.


This not-quite-annual event was first started around 2002-03 after Marsha Miller had the idea to host a Yoga on High patron event. Miller, one of the owners of the establishment, wanted to create a fun opportunity that could build relationships and community within the company’s supporters.


The summertime potluck and talent show is mainly for Yoga on High patrons, but other members of the neighborhood are welcome to come and enjoy the show. So far a belly dancer, a comedian, and an organized dance troupe have signed on to participate in the talent show, and many more guests are expected to register. Contestants will have around five minutes to showcase their talent, and pre-registration is required at the front desk before July 16.


As popularity demanded another summer fling, Yoga on High can’t wait to see their students’ and patrons’ talent. Guests should bring a covered vegetarian dish to share with their fellow yogis, and should also be prepared to share lots of laughter and good times with the audience.
